WormBase Gene ID  ? WBGene00018657 Gene Name  acl-4
Sequence Name  ? F49H12.6 Brief Description  acl-4 encodes a phosphate acyltransferase; ACL-4 is predicted to be a membrane protein that functions in phospholipid biosynthesis; acl-4 expression can be detected in the pharynx, intestine, hypodermis, muscle, and reproductive system.
Organism  Caenorhabditis elegans Automated Description  Predicted to enable acyltransferase activity, transferring groups other than amino-acyl groups. Predicted to be involved in phospholipid biosynthetic process. Located in endoplasmic reticulum. Is an ortholog of human GPAT3 (glycerol-3-phosphate acyltransferase 3).
